MV Transportation, Inc., Fairfield, CA, 1999 to 2008
Chief Financial O�cer
As CFO for MV Transportation, Gary was able to expand their bank credit line from $15M to $85M
through a series of expansions to account for their company’s growth from one state with ten
operating locations to twenty-six states and one hundred twenty locations. As equity is the most
expensive form of capital, Gary recognized it is most cost effective to create a capital structure that
secures the most funding, offers the lowest cost of capital, and maximizes return on equity. Thus, he
was able to negotiate $15M of coupon-only mezzanine debt.
Using best practices, he developed a scorecard system to benchmark performance of operating
locations. Through his benchmarking, he was able to diagnose problems and develop action plans to
improve struggling areas using key financial indicators. Gary also designed and organized an
insurance captive that generated cash flows through tax deferrals of $4.5M during a four year period
(‘04-‘07). To minimize fraud and abuse, Gary launched an internal audit department within MV.
